Description
1H-Azepine,Hexahydro-1-(Iminomethyl)-(9Ci) CAS NO 158949-35-0 is a specialized heterocyclic organic compound featuring an azepine ring core functionalized with an iminomethyl group. This unique structure makes it a valuable and versatile building block and intermediate in advanced synthetic chemistry. It is primarily utilized by research institutions and industrial R&D departments focused on developing novel pharmaceuticals, agrochemicals, and functional materials.

Storage
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at a controlled room temperature (typically 15-25°C). This compound is easily oxidized and should be handled and stored under an inert atmosphere (e.g., nitrogen or argon) for long-term stability. Keep away from heat, sparks, and open flame.
